Position Scope:
Reporting to the Director Credit the role holder will be responsible for credit approvals for Islamic Banking business loans through analysis of credit applications in accordance with the Bank’s lending policies, Shariah law, CBK Prudential Guidelines and best practice to achieve quality growth in the retail asset book in line with the strategic plans. .

Key Responsibilities
• Evaluate and approve shariah compliant credit proposals (new, renewals, one offs, permanent, amendments, cancellations, etc.) received from Islamic Banking department in line with specific credit guidelines as set within existing policy/manual/product documents, understanding of market, industry, economic factors, financial statements, etc., and recommending those beyond DLA for consideration
• Verify & analyze credit information, documentation such as bank statements, financials, etc. provided by RMs/Customers, and seek clarification, if needed from other sources, liaise with RM for queries, additional information / documents, business recommendations for deviations, if needed.
• Visit clients/Centers/Branches, independently or with RMs/Manager as part of the evaluation of credit proposals for better understanding of the client, business and market
• Review on a periodic basis, a sample of credit decisions made by Credit authority holders within the unit
• Attend to Audit requirements and provide responses to audit remarks/ensure rectification thereof in respect of Personal Credit Department
• Monitor Islamic Banking portfolio for renewals, limits dropping, early vintage performance, migration and PAR
• Monitor compliance with TAT and other service level agreements

Qualifications, Experience, Skills & Personal Attributes:
•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Business, Statistics, Mathematics, Economics, Computer Science or related fields from a recognized institution.
• Certified Public Accountant ( CPA- K) or its equivalent
• Eight (8) years’ experience in Credit function out of which 5 years should be at Head or senior management level handling Islamic Banking in a financial institution.
• Business acumen/ commercial awareness; ability to thoroughly and independently assess business strategies, alignment and implementation plans.
• Leading teams; capable of empowering and leading teams to meet Bank goals
• Leading change; proven change management capability to drive and align teams to strategy.
• Innovation; able to keep up with trends of meeting the demands of internal and external customers and controls thereof.
• Collaboration; forms business partnerships that help drive the Bank’s agenda.
• Multi-tasking; able to manage several concurrent assignments and prioritize demands
